Compliance with Florida Labor Laws in Scheduling

Maintaining compliance with labor regulations is a critical consideration for retail businesses in Pompano Beach. Florida’s labor laws contain specific provisions that affect scheduling practices, and violations can result in costly penalties, legal issues, and damage to your business reputation. Effective scheduling services should include compliance safeguards to protect your business.

  • Minor Employment Restrictions: Florida has strict regulations regarding work hours for employees under 18, including limitations on night work and total weekly hours during school periods.
  • Break Requirements: While Florida doesn’t mandate breaks for adult employees, federal labor laws require that any breaks provided under 20 minutes must be paid time.
  • Overtime Regulations: Non-exempt employees must receive overtime pay for hours worked beyond 40 in a workweek, requiring careful tracking of scheduled hours.
  • Reporting Time Considerations: Best practices suggest compensating employees who report for scheduled shifts but are sent home early due to low customer traffic.
  • Record-Keeping Requirements: Florida employers must maintain accurate records of employee work hours for at least three years, with scheduling systems providing valuable documentation.

Modern scheduling solutions include built-in compliance features that automatically flag potential violations before schedules are published. For example, labor compliance tools can alert managers if an employee is scheduled for too many consecutive days or if a minor is assigned hours that violate state restrictions. These automated safeguards are particularly valuable for small retailers without dedicated HR departments to monitor compliance issues.

Integration with Other Business Systems

Maximizing the value of scheduling services requires effective integration with other business systems used in retail operations. When scheduling software communicates seamlessly with point-of-sale systems, time and attendance tools, payroll software, and other platforms, it creates a more efficient, accurate, and insightful business ecosystem.

  • POS Integration: Connection with point-of-sale systems allows scheduling based on sales volume patterns and enables calculation of labor cost as a percentage of sales.
  • Time and Attendance Synchronization: Automatic comparison of scheduled versus actual work hours helps identify attendance issues and ensures accurate payroll processing.
  • Payroll System Connection: Direct transfer of approved hours to payroll systems eliminates duplicate data entry and reduces errors in employee compensation.
  • HR Software Integration: Sharing employee data between systems ensures scheduling respects employment status, approved time off, and certification requirements.
  • Reporting and Analytics Tools: Integration with business intelligence platforms provides deeper insights into scheduling efficiency and labor utilization.

3. What labor laws in Florida affect retail employee scheduling?

Florida follows federal labor standards with some state-specific provisions that impact retail scheduling. While Florida doesn’t have predictive scheduling laws like some states, employers must comply with federal overtime requirements, paying non-exempt employees 1.5 times their regular rate for hours worked beyond 40 in a workweek. Florida has strict regulations for minors: those under 16 cannot work before 7 a.m. or after 7 p.m. (9 p.m. in summer), while 16-17 year-olds cannot work before 6:30 a.m. or after 11 p.m. when school follows. During school periods, minors’ hours are limited based on age. Florida doesn’t mandate meal or rest breaks for adults, but any breaks under 20 minutes must be paid. Employers must also maintain accurate records of all hours worked for at least three years. Using scheduling software with compliance checks helps prevent violations of these regulations.

5. What’s the typical implementation timeline for scheduling software in a small retail business?

For small retail businesses in Pompano Beach, implementing scheduling software typically takes between 2-4 weeks from decision to full deployment. The process begins with system configuration (3-5 days), including setting up store information, job roles, and scheduling rules. Data migration follows (3-7 days), transferring employee information, availability, and historical scheduling patterns. Manager training (1-2 days) and employee training (1 day) ensure everyone understands how to use the system effectively. The initial schedule creation using the new system (1-2 days) often runs parallel with existing methods as a safety net. Following implementation, expect a 2-3 week adjustment period for team members to become comfortable with the new processes. Vendors offering dedicated implementation support can help accelerate this timeline and smooth the transition. Most retailers report reaching full operational efficiency with new scheduling systems within 4-6 weeks of initial implementation.
